Operation

LOW GAS PRESSURE MODELS

Low gas pressure switches break the electrical circuit on

pressure drop at the point when gas pressure becomes

lower than the indicated set pressure.

In order to reset the switch, the gas pressure in the

chamber must be higher than the indicated setting. For

manual reset switches, the reset button must also then be

pressed.

HIGH GAS PRESSURE MODELS

High gas pressure switches break the electrical circuit

when pressure rises above the indicated preset pressure.

In order to reset the switch, the gas pressure in the

chamber must be lower than the indicated setting. For

manual reset switches, the reset button must also then be

pressed.

RANGE ADJUSTMENT (ALL MODELS)

To adjust gas pressure cutoff setting, remove the cover.

Turn the range scale adjustable knob (Figure 6) clock-

wise to increase pressure setting, counterclockwise to

decrease pressure setting. Install cover and tighten the

two cover screws to prevent tampering.

Mounting

All switches can be mounted in either horizontal or verti-

cal position. Switches should be reasonably level but do

not require accurate leveling.

Single gas switch models have a 1/4" NPT (female) gas

inlet on the standard base.

Piping can either be standard black pipe or aluminum tub-

ing.

All switches can be support by the inlet pipe, but optional

mounting brackets and bases are available (see Figures

1 through 5).

Switches have been factory calibrated and tested for

leaks. However, it is recommended that switch, gas pipe

inlets, and connections be soap bubble tested for leaks

after installation.
